What is Gambling?

Gambling is the act of risking money or valuables on an event with an uncertain outcome, primarily with the intent of winning additional money or goods. It encompasses a wide range of activities, including betting on sports, playing card games, and engaging in casino games. The thrill of gambling often comes from the risk involved and the potential for a large reward. However, it is essential to understand the inherent risks and the nature of chance that plays a crucial role in these activities. The Importance of Understanding Odds

Odds are a fundamental concept in gambling, representing the likelihood of a particular outcome occurring. They can determine how much you can win if your bet is successful. Understanding how to read and interpret odds is vital for making informed decisions. Odds can be presented in various formats, including fractional, decimal, and American, and knowing how to convert between them can be advantageous. Bankroll Management Strategies

Effective bankroll management is critical for anyone starting in gambling. It involves setting a budget for how much you are willing to spend and sticking to it. This practice not only helps protect your finances but also enhances your overall gaming experience. Many beginners fall into the trap of chasing losses, which can lead to significant financial strain.

To manage your bankroll effectively, consider allocating a specific amount for each gambling session and avoid exceeding it. Additionally, it’s wise to have a plan for when to stop playing, whether you’ve reached your win goal or if you’ve lost a certain amount. This disciplined approach can help prevent impulsive decisions that might lead to regret.
